Commit a210b9b4 authored by arawankar's avatar arawankar

CustStock.java

CustStockItem.java
CustStockTransit.java
-Changes made to validate customer series depends on disparm variable.
-If disparm value is "Y" then ,system should check count in customer series against cust_code and item_ser.

git-svn-id: http://15.206.35.175/svn/proteus/business-java/trunk@197425 ce508802-f39f-4f6c-b175-0d175dae99d5
parent db14bdf9
...@@ -470,6 +470,13 @@ public class CustStock extends ValidatorEJB //implements SessionBean ...@@ -470,6 +470,13 @@ public class CustStock extends ValidatorEJB //implements SessionBean
{ {
custCode = genericUtility.getColumnValue("cust_code",dom); custCode = genericUtility.getColumnValue("cust_code",dom);
itemSer = genericUtility.getColumnValue("item_ser",dom); itemSer = genericUtility.getColumnValue("item_ser",dom);
//Modified by Anjali R. on [20/02/2019][Customer series validation Will call upon disparam variable value.][Start]
String serSpecificCust = "";
DistCommon distCommon = new DistCommon();
serSpecificCust = distCommon.getDisparams("999999", "SER_SPECIFIC_CUST", conn);
if("Y".equalsIgnoreCase(serSpecificCust))
{
//Modified by Anjali R. on [20/02/2019][Customer series validation Will call upon disparam variable value.][End]
selQueryBuff = new StringBuffer(); selQueryBuff = new StringBuffer();
selQueryBuff.append("SELECT NVL(COUNT(*),0) FROM CUSTOMER_SERIES WHERE CUST_CODE = '"); selQueryBuff.append("SELECT NVL(COUNT(*),0) FROM CUSTOMER_SERIES WHERE CUST_CODE = '");
selQueryBuff.append(custCode).append("' AND ITEM_SER = '"); selQueryBuff.append(custCode).append("' AND ITEM_SER = '");
...@@ -487,6 +494,7 @@ public class CustStock extends ValidatorEJB //implements SessionBean ...@@ -487,6 +494,7 @@ public class CustStock extends ValidatorEJB //implements SessionBean
break; break;
} }
} }
}
if (stmt2 != null) if (stmt2 != null)
{ {
stmt2.close(); stmt2.close();
......
...@@ -530,6 +530,14 @@ public class CustStockItem extends ValidatorEJB //implements SessionBean ...@@ -530,6 +530,14 @@ public class CustStockItem extends ValidatorEJB //implements SessionBean
{ {
custCode = genericUtility.getColumnValue("cust_code",dom); custCode = genericUtility.getColumnValue("cust_code",dom);
itemSer = genericUtility.getColumnValue("item_ser",dom); itemSer = genericUtility.getColumnValue("item_ser",dom);
//Modified by Anjali R. on [20/02/2019][Customer series validation Will call upon disparam variable value.][Start]
String serSpecificCust = "";
DistCommon distCommon = new DistCommon();
serSpecificCust = distCommon.getDisparams("999999", "SER_SPECIFIC_CUST", conn);
if("Y".equalsIgnoreCase(serSpecificCust))
{
//Modified by Anjali R. on [20/02/2019][Customer series validation Will call upon disparam variable value.][End]
selQueryBuff = new StringBuffer(); selQueryBuff = new StringBuffer();
//selQueryBuff.append("SELECT NVL(COUNT(*),0) FROM CUSTOMER_SERIES WHERE CUST_CODE = '"); //selQueryBuff.append("SELECT NVL(COUNT(*),0) FROM CUSTOMER_SERIES WHERE CUST_CODE = '");
//selQueryBuff.append(custCode).append("' AND ITEM_SER = '"); //selQueryBuff.append(custCode).append("' AND ITEM_SER = '");
...@@ -552,6 +560,7 @@ public class CustStockItem extends ValidatorEJB //implements SessionBean ...@@ -552,6 +560,7 @@ public class CustStockItem extends ValidatorEJB //implements SessionBean
break; break;
} }
} }
}
if( rs2 != null ) if( rs2 != null )
{ {
rs2.close(); rs2.close();
......
...@@ -471,6 +471,13 @@ public class CustStockTransit extends ValidatorEJB //implements SessionBean ...@@ -471,6 +471,13 @@ public class CustStockTransit extends ValidatorEJB //implements SessionBean
{ {
custCode = getColumnValue("cust_code",dom); custCode = getColumnValue("cust_code",dom);
itemSer = getColumnValue("item_ser",dom); itemSer = getColumnValue("item_ser",dom);
//Modified by Anjali R. on [20/02/2019][Customer series validation Will call upon disparam variable value.][Start]
String serSpecificCust = "";
DistCommon distCommon = new DistCommon();
serSpecificCust = distCommon.getDisparams("999999", "SER_SPECIFIC_CUST", conn);
if("Y".equalsIgnoreCase(serSpecificCust))
{
//Modified by Anjali R. on [20/02/2019][Customer series validation Will call upon disparam variable value.][End]
selQueryBuff = new StringBuffer(); selQueryBuff = new StringBuffer();
selQueryBuff.append("SELECT NVL(COUNT(*),0) FROM CUSTOMER_SERIES WHERE CUST_CODE = '"); selQueryBuff.append("SELECT NVL(COUNT(*),0) FROM CUSTOMER_SERIES WHERE CUST_CODE = '");
selQueryBuff.append(custCode).append("' AND ITEM_SER = '"); selQueryBuff.append(custCode).append("' AND ITEM_SER = '");
...@@ -493,6 +500,7 @@ public class CustStockTransit extends ValidatorEJB //implements SessionBean ...@@ -493,6 +500,7 @@ public class CustStockTransit extends ValidatorEJB //implements SessionBean
stmt2 = null; stmt2 = null;
} }
} }
}
if (stmt != null) if (stmt != null)
{ {
stmt.close(); stmt.close();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ment